Purpose:
Performs repairs and installations to a variety of hardware, equipment, structural and surface materials in accordance with diagrams, plans, operation manuals and manufacturer's specifications.
Responsibilities:
 

  • Perform repairs and installation of wood, metal and plastic laminate items to include shelving, cabinets, tables, counters, wall bumpers and doors.
  • Perform in accordance with system-wide competencies/behaviors.
  • Smooth and removes old paint; fills nail holes, cracks and joints with putty or other filler to prepare surfaces for sealer, primers or finish coat.
  • Fill out work tickets with the appropriate information.
  • Maintain the necessary personal tools to carry out craft duties and keeps tools in a safe and reliable condition.
  • Combine lock cores and keys.
  • Remove and install new and existing equipment as directed.
  • Order necessary parts and material through the established procedures.
  • Install and repair a variety of door hardware and equipment.
  • Responsible for following the mandatory reporting procedures for any incident or serious event that did affect or potentially could have affected the clinical care of any patient.
  • Oversee and directs laborers when assigned to assist.
  • Update plans and drawings as required to reflect work carried out.
  • Perform repairs as needed to walls from ongoing work and to decorate/protect areas.
  • Document work functions for regulatory agencies through the Preventative Maintenance Program.
  • Size and engrave signage in accordance with diagrams and specifications.
  • Assist the other crafts in completing their duties.
  • Demonstrate safe work habits.
